Expand description
Consists of a primary cluster that accepts writes and an associated secondary cluster that resides in a different Amazon region. The secondary cluster accepts only reads. The primary cluster automatically replicates updates to the secondary cluster.
-
The GlobalReplicationGroupIdSuffix represents the name of the Global datastore, which is what you use to associate a secondary cluster.
Fields (Non-exhaustive)§
This struct is marked as non-exhaustive
Struct { .. }
syntax; cannot be matched against without a wildcard ..
; and struct update syntax will not work.global_replication_group_id: Option<String>
The name of the Global datastore
global_replication_group_description: Option<String>
The optional description of the Global datastore
status: Option<String>
The status of the Global datastore
cache_node_type: Option<String>
The cache node type of the Global datastore
engine: Option<String>
The Elasticache engine. For Redis only.
engine_version: Option<String>
The Elasticache Redis engine version.
members: Option<Vec<GlobalReplicationGroupMember>>
The replication groups that comprise the Global datastore.
cluster_enabled: Option<bool>
A flag that indicates whether the Global datastore is cluster enabled.
global_node_groups: Option<Vec<GlobalNodeGroup>>
Indicates the slot configuration and global identifier for each slice group.
auth_token_enabled: Option<bool>
A flag that enables using an AuthToken
(password) when issuing Redis commands.
Default: false
transit_encryption_enabled: Option<bool>
A flag that enables in-transit encryption when set to true.
Required: Only available when creating a replication group in an Amazon VPC using redis version 3.2.6
, 4.x
or later.
at_rest_encryption_enabled: Option<bool>
A flag that enables encryption at rest when set to true
.
You cannot modify the value of AtRestEncryptionEnabled
after the replication group is created. To enable encryption at rest on a replication group you must set AtRestEncryptionEnabled
to true
when you create the replication group.
Required: Only available when creating a replication group in an Amazon VPC using redis version 3.2.6
, 4.x
or later.
arn: Option<String>
The ARN (Amazon Resource Name) of the global replication group.
